More Sprites Plans!

Hey folks! We’ve just shipped more Sprites plans for those that want a higher concurrent active Sprites allowance. Plans include the listed monthly allowances. Usage beyond included amounts is billed at standard usage-based rates (see Sprites - Stateful sandboxes):

Plan Price/month Max Concurrent Active Sprites Max Warm Sprites CPU/hours RAM/hours Storage/GB-months Support
Adventurer
Level 20
$20.00 20 20 450 1800 50 Community
Veteran
Level 50
$50.00 50 50 800 3200 100 Community
Hero
Level 100
$100.00 100 100 1200 4800 150 Standard
Champion
Level 200
$200.00 200 200 1800 7200 225 Standard
Legend
Level 500
$500.00 500 500 3200 12500 400 Standard
Epic
Level 1000
$1000.00 1000 1000 4800 18750 600 Premium
Mythic
Level 2000
$2000.00 2000 2000 7200 28000 900 Premium
Guild Custom Custom Custom Custom Custom Custom Custom

All plans except Mythic and Guild are self-service from the Sprites dashboard. If you’re interested in either of those two top-limit plans, reach out to billing@fly.io (you can also click “Contact Us” in the dashboard, it’ll open up an email template addressed to that email).

You can’t change plans just yet, we’ll have that out ASAP next week (likely by EOD Monday).

For anyone who already purchased the one paid plan we had prior to this, you’re effectively on Adventurer now!
